Published purpose
Reaction Dynamics (RDX) is developing a hybrid rocket engine that will power a low cost, eco-friendly, orbital launch vehicle. A key part of this endeavour is the development of a carbon neutral fuel for the rocket engine. The following project has for main goal the selection of a fuel mixture that will maximize performance, while being made of bioderived polymers. Of key interest are determining the thermal, mechanical, and transport properties (specific heat, heat of combustion, thermal conductivity, strength, etc), that are required for best performance in RDX’s engines. Then, working with a bioderived polymer supplier, RDX will manufacture a fuel with net-zero emissions and test it in a demonstrator rocket engine.
